Bids fly in from around the world for a Kent pilot’s royal gifts - Hansons Auctioneers

A pair of gold cufflinks presented by Queen Elizabeth II to the pilot who flew the body of the Duke of Windsor back to the UK sold for £1,700 – more than four times its low guide price of £400 at Hansons Auctioneers’ Kent saleroom in Penshurst today .
